应用程序退出是指用户在使用移动应用或桌面软件时,应用程序意外关闭或崩溃的现象。这种情况不仅让用户感到困惑和不便,还可能导致数据丢失和使用体验下降。
应用程序退出的原因多种多样,可能是由于代码错误、内存溢出、兼容性问题、网络连接不稳定等。了解这些原因对于预防和解决问题至关重要。
致命的应用程序退出会严重影响用户体验。当用户在执行关键操作时,应用程序突然退出,会让用户感到失望和不满,甚至会放弃继续使用该应用。
对于企业来说,应用程序退出不仅影响用户满意度,还会直接影响业务收入。如果一个应用频繁出现退出问题,用户可能会转向竞争对手的产品,导致用户流失和收入下降。
内存泄漏是导致应用程序退出的常见技术原因之一。当应用程序未能正确释放不再使用的内存时,会导致系统内存不足,最终引发应用程序崩溃。
不同设备和操作系统版本之间的兼容性问题也可能导致应用程序退出。开发者需要确保应用程序在各种设备和操作系统上都能正常运行。
网络连接的不稳定或中断也会导致应用程序退出。特别是对于需要持续联网的应用程序,如在线游戏或流媒体服务,网络问题会对其稳定性产生重大影响。
用户的误操作也可能导致应用程序退出。例如,用户在使用应用时意外关闭应用,或在不适当的时机切换应用,都会导致退出问题。
现代设备支持多任务处理,但这也可能带来问题。如果用户同时运行多个应用,系统资源可能被过度占用,从而导致应用程序退出。
优化代码是预防应用程序退出的基础。开发者应定期检查和优化代码,避免内存泄漏和其他性能问题。
定期更新和维护是确保应用程序稳定运行的关键。通过定期更新,开发者可以修复已知问题并提升应用性能。
加强用户培训,帮助用户正确使用应用程序,也可以减少因误操作导致的应用程序退出。通过提供使用指南和常见问题解答,用户可以更好地了解如何操作应用程序。
某知名应用程序曾因频繁退出问题遭到用户投诉。经过调查,发现问题源于内存泄漏和兼容性问题。
开发团队通过优化代码和加强测试,成功解决了应用程序退出问题。更新发布后,用户满意度显著提升,应用评分也有所上升。
收集用户反馈可以帮助开发者及时发现和解决应用程序问题。常用的方法包括用户调查、在线评论、社交媒体监测等。
根据用户反馈,开发者可以有针对性地改进应用程序,提升用户体验。例如,修复用户反馈的bug,增加用户期望的新功能等。
开发者可以使用多种工具来优化和测试应用程序,如Android Studio、Xcode、Firebase等。这些工具可以帮助开发者检测和修复应用程序中的问题。
测试是确保应用程序稳定性的关键。开发者应采用自动化测试和手动测试相结合的方法,覆盖各种使用场
网友评论